Public title: A Trial Evaluating the Clinical Applicability, Correlation, and Modeling of Cardiac CT Using 64 Detector Row VCT
Scientific title: An Open-Label, Non-Randomized, Multi-Center Trial Evaluating the Clinical Applicability, Correlation, and Modeling of Cardiac CT Using 64 Detector Row VCT
Date of first enrolment: October 2005
Target sample size: 144
Recruitment status: Completed
URL:  http://clinicaltrials.gov/show/NCT00350506
Study type:  Interventional
Study design:  Allocation: Non-Randomized, Endpoint Classification: Efficacy Study, Intervention Model: Single Group Assignment, Masking: Open Label, Primary Purpose: Diagnostic

Key inclusion & exclusion criteria

Inclusion Criteria:

- Patients scheduled for elective diagnostic catheterization OR

- Elective diagnostic catheterization has been performed within the past 2 weeks but no
less than 24 hours prior to the coronary CTA procedure with no intervention performed
or change of the patient clinical status.

- Age =18 years but =75 years.

Exclusion Criteria:

- Prior coronary stent implantation

- Prior coronary artery bypass grafting or other heart surgery

- Prior pacemaker or internal defibrillator lead implantation

- Prior artificial heart valve

- Biochemical renal insufficiency (CrSerum > 1.6) or on dialysis

- Resting HR > 100 at the time of enrollment

- Contraindication to ß-blockade or calcium channel blocker

- NYHA-IV

- High-grade atrioventricular (AV) block

- Systolic blood pressure <90 mm Hg

- Severe asthma or active bronchospasm and/or chronic obstructive pulmonary
disease

- Atrial fibrillation

- Inability to provide informed consent

- Evidence of ongoing or active clinical instability

- Acute chest pain (sudden onset)

- Acute myocardial infarction

- Cardiac shock

- Acute pulmonary edema
